Gordo is so adorable!! I was an only child who grew up in the country with cats and dogs. They were my company...often felt like they were siblings. To be honest I never really felt the terrible urge to have children but have always wanted cats and dogs in my life. I have 3 cats...2 females and 1 male...all fixed/neutered. I live in a small 2 bedroom house and my cats are indoors only due to living in the country near a busy road. I have 4 cats trees which to me were a great investment for me and the cats. Sometimes all 3 are asleep on 1 cat tree and sometimes they are all on different trees. All 4 cat trees are near windows and the cats all "chatter" at birds that land on the bushes outside the windows. The cats are really good at scratching the areas on the cat trees and every now and then I need to reattach the rope with glue as they have gotten carried away...which is better than going for the furniture. A few tips for you to think about...1) Leave your kitty carrier out with the door open so they can freely go in and out if it rather than bringing it out only when they have a scheduled vet appointment. If they are used to it it isn't as traumatic for them when you gave to pack them up to go to the vet. 2) I get my kitty litter delivered by Chewy.com or Amazon so I can have a fair amount at home. 3) Get your kitties used to being brushed. My male kitty loves to be brushed and he comes when I'm sitting by the table where I keep the brush and literally taps me on the leg so I will brush him. Getting them used to being brushed keeps loose fur off of them so they won't lick themselves and OD on loose fur and then get fur balls that they will throw up. In cats, the colors black and orange are linked to the X chromosome. Each X can only have one of the two colors, which is why almost all calicos are girls! If there’s a boy calico, he actually has three sex chromosomes (XXY)!
